92% public across 253,309 ac. Real backcountry here — 68% of the public land sits more than a mile from any road. Little to no landlocked public land.

Land & access

USFS 91%SFW 1%SLB 0%□ Private 8%
Unit area253,309 ac
Public land232,991 ac (92%)
Landlocked public76 ac (0.0%)
Motorized routes (MVUM + roads)248 mi
Maintained trails522 mi

Backcountry

Public land >1 mi from a road158,484 ac (68% of public)
Road density0.63 mi/mi²
Managed byUSFS 231k ac · SFW 1k ac · SLB 1k ac

How these numbers are made

public_land_pct = public_area / unit_area
landlocked = public ∖ reachable(roads, corners)
remote = public ∖ buffer(roads, 1 mi)
